Joey Porter
I already made the biggest statement. The league is hypocritical for allowing Matt Jones to play while they're fining guys like me for even breathing
John Seibel (2:09 PM)
i understand why the league hesitated on acting on Matt Jones. since roger goodell took over as commish, they've allowed the judicial system work itself out before acting themself. i do, however, think the jaguars have been a monumental failure for not de-activating him. look what the steelers did with santonio holmes, and that was for pot. jones gets the club's get-out-of-jail-free card for COKE! that's pitiful.

Jerry (STAMP IT, GA)
So, Seibel...just how much of an enigma are the Colts?
John Seibel (2:29 PM)
wrapped up in a conundrum.... i think the colts issues are clear, actually. peyton is NOT healthy. he's missing an awful lot of passes by leaving them high. that's a clear sign the left knee is not right, and he's hesitant to plant that left foot.
Steve (Syracuse, NY)
Why not believe in the titans? They are BUILT for the winter months! They run the ball and play D---the two things that transition year round.
John Seibel (2:30 PM)
i love their D. i love their running game, but come january, all teams are good. good teams tend to be able to shut down 1-dimension of the other team's offense. can the titans throw the ball and win? i'm not comfortable with that yet. i like what kerry collins has done in the huddle in the wake of the vince young soap opera, but the passing game has yet to carry the day.
